Enter Vani Hari, a.k.a. The Food Babe. She’s part food sleuth, part truth-teller, and 100% fed up with chemical cocktails in our snacks. What started with a personal health scare turned into a full-on movement—and she’s changing the game, one ingredient list at a time.

From Fast Food Fan to Food Label Crusader
Once a processed-food lover, Vani had a wake-up call when she discovered just how many questionable chemicals were in her go-to meals. Think preservatives, dyes, and additives banned in Europe but alive and well in American pantries.
Her Latest Win: Bye Dye
Remember Kraft Mac & Cheese? Vani’s campaign helped get the artificial dyes removed. And she’s not stopping there—her activism recently pushed for major changes across the industry, even influencing state laws to restrict harmful food dyes.
